Midway have sent along another trailer for the upcoming Mortal Kombat vs DC Universe - the far fetched fighting game that sees the MK characters squaring off against the DC Comic crew.

This weeks video features The Joker. The 2 minute clip shows off a mix of the game's hokey cut-scenes and The Joker's gameplay. Check it out right here in the AusGamers video library.

Mortal Kombat vs DC Universe is due on November 22 2008 for Xbox 360 and PC. Stop by the AusGamers game page for all the other trailers released to-date.
